我真的不熟悉编码/linux我想找一行包含XX Number 1.2.3.4或XX Number 1.2.-.-的代码
最初,我只是通过执行以下操作来进行硬编码
grep "XX Number" filename | cut -c 15-
但是后来我意识到有一些文件在他们的行中有单词"XX Number“,这会搞砸的。
下面是一个示例(请注意,多个空格是字面制表符):
XX Number 1.2.3.4
XX Number 1.2.-.-
Another line with XX Number that shouldn'
我有一个文本文件,必须在其中剪切字段3、4、5和8:
219 432 4567 Harrison Joel M 4540 Accountant 09-12-1985
219 433 4587 Mitchell Barbara C 4541 Admin Asst 12-14-1995
219 433 3589 Olson Timothy H 4544 Supervisor 06-30-1983
219 433 4591 Moore Sarah H 4500 Dept Manager 08-01-19
作为一个linux的新手,我有一个问题。我有一个文件列表(这次是由svn状态产生的),我想创建一个脚本来循环它们,并用4个空格替换制表符。
所以我想从
....
D HTML/templates/t_bla.tpl
M HTML/templates/t_list_markt.tpl
M HTML/templates/t_vip.tpl
M HTML/templates/upsell.tpl
M HTML/templates/t_warranty.tpl
M HTML/templates/top.tpl
A + HTML/temp
上下文:我正在创建一个shell函数,以更人性化的方式输出git rev-list信息(灵感来自于)。
但我因为我无法解释的意外行为而受阻。下面是一个例子:
REVLIST="$(git rev-list --left-right --count main...fix/preview-data)"
# just to check what the variable contains
$echo \"$REVLIST\" # outputs "57 0"
# This is the unexpected behavior: cut di
我有一个包含大量数据的文本文件,其中以制表符分隔。我想查看一下数据,这样我就可以看到列中的唯一值。例如,
Red Ball 1 Sold
Blue Bat 5 OnSale
...............
因此,就像第一列有颜色一样,我想知道该列中有多少个不同的唯一值,并且我希望能够对每一列执行此操作。
我需要在Linux命令行中执行此操作,因此可能需要使用一些bash脚本、sed、awk或其他命令。
如果我也想要这些唯一值的计数呢?
更新:我想我没有把第二部分讲得足够清楚。我想要做的是对这些唯一值中的“每个”值进行计数,而不知道有多少个唯一值。例如,在第一列中,我想知道有多
我有50,000行选项卡解压缩的文本文件。我想拆分第一列并打印,如output.txt所示
Input.txt
rt|371443144|mb|MN556661.1| 2200443 A
rt|371443344|mb|MN556645.1| 2594155 A
rt|371467899|mb|MN555666.1| 2594175 A
output.txt
MN556661.1 2200443 A
MN556645.1 2594155 A
MN555666.1 2594175 A
我的abc.log包含以下条目(代码片段):
...
INFO #my-service# #add# id=67986324423 isTrial=true
INFO #my-service# #add# id=43536343643 isTrial=false
INFO #my-service# #add# id=43634636365 isTrial=true
INFO #my-service# #add# id=67986324423 isTrial=true
INFO #my-service# #delete# id=43634636365 isTrial=true
INFO #my-